- 1 minute to read
- Print
- DarkLight
- PDF
API secrets
- 1 minute to read
- Print
- DarkLight
- PDF
The MySafe API secrets feature enables users to securely store sensitive API information, such as Client Secret
and Client ID
, for both personal and team corporate use.
Functionalities
Add, edit, view, share, deactivate, and reactivate your API secrets.
Applicability
- Protect your personal and team corporate API information.
- Securely share your API secrets with other MySafe users and external users.
Use case
Integrating a system with an external API
Primary actor: Charles (Developer at a technology company.)
Summary: this use case demonstrates how Charles can securely store, share, and protect API secrets when integrating an internal system with an external API using MySafe.
Basic flow
Storing the API secret: Charles receives an API secret to integrate an internal system with an external API that provides critical data for the company's operations. He uses MySafe to securely store the key, categorizing it as "Integration with external API."
Secure access: to configure the internal system, Charles uses the API secret stored in MySafe without exposing it directly, minimizing the risk of credential leaks.
Controlled sharing: Charles's colleague Ana needs access to an API secret to perform system maintenance. Charles uses MySafe's sharing functionality to grant Ana temporary view access to the secret. After Ana completes the maintenance, Charles revokes the access and edits the secret as needed, ensuring Ana no longer has access to the information.
Benefits
- Security and confidentiality: Charles ensures that API secrets are protected and accessible only to authorized individuals.
- Automation and efficiency: the MySafe API secrets feature helps Charles automate system integration securely, reducing the risk of human error.
- Accessibility and mobility: through MySafe, Charles can access API secrets from anywhere, at any time, ensuring agility in his tasks.